Average Postal Service Mail Carriers Salary in East-Central Montana nonmetropolitan area

The average salary for Postal Service Mail Carrierss in East-Central Montana nonmetropolitan area is $52,690. While this is lower than the national average, the cost of living in East-Central Montana nonmetropolitan area may offset the difference, preserving real purchasing power.

Postal Service Mail Carriers Salary Distribution in East-Central Montana nonmetropolitan area

The earning potential for Postal Service Mail Carrierss in East-Central Montana nonmetropolitan area varies significantly by experience level. The salary gap is relatively narrow, suggesting consistent and predictable earnings from entry-level to senior positions. Entry-level roles (10th percentile) typically start around $41,250, while highly experienced professionals can command wages upwards of $68,020.

How much does a Postal Service Mail Carriers make in East-Central Montana nonmetropolitan area?

The median annual salary for a Postal Service Mail Carriers in East-Central Montana nonmetropolitan area is $52,690. This typically ranges from $41,250 for entry-level positions to $68,020 for top-level roles.

How does the salary compare to the national average?

The average salary for this role in East-Central Montana nonmetropolitan area is 12.0% lower than the national median of $59,880.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 100 employees in the East-Central Montana nonmetropolitan area area with a job density of 1.662 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
